House Priceson Cooper Lane

Sale prices range from £102,968 for 2 bedroom Leasehold flats with a garden (656 ft2) to £237,371 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,044 ft2) .

Monthly rental prices range from £740 pcm for 2 bed flats to £1,421 pcm for 3 bed houses.

The gross rental yield is between 7.2% and 8.6%.

The average value per square foot is £248.

Sales History
on Cooper Lane, Manchester, M9

The last sale was on 12th December 2025 for £230,000 and since then the market in the area has increased by 0.6%. The street has had a total of 35 sales since 1995.

Cooper Lane, Manchester, M9 has seen 8 sales in the last three years and 3 sales in the last twelve months.
